M&T Bank (NYSE:MTB) PT Raised to $174.00 at Royal Bank of Canada

M&T Bank (NYSE:MTBFree Report) had its price target increased by Royal Bank of Canada from $160.00 to $174.00 in a research report released on Friday, Benzinga reports. They currently have an outperform rating on the financial services provider’s stock.

Several other research analysts also recently commented on the stock.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ods raised their price objective on shares of M&T Bank from $170.00 to $180.00 and gave the stock a market perform rating in a report on Friday. Jefferies Financial Group lifted their price target on M&T Bank from $160.00 to $161.00 and gave the company a hold rating in a research report on Wednesday, July 3rd. Wedbush reissued an outperform rating and set a $170.00 price objective on shares of M&T Bank in a report on Wednesday, April 10th. Bank of America lifted their target price on M&T Bank from $157.00 to $160.00 and gave the company a buy rating in a report on Tuesday, April 16th.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. increased their price target on shares of M&T Bank from $170.00 to $180.00 and gave the stock a neutral rating in a report on Tuesday, April 16th. Ten research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and six have issued a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of Hold and a consensus price target of $170.17.

M&T Bank Stock Performance

Shares of MTB stock opened at $170.87 on Friday. The firm has a 50 day moving average of $150.83 and a 200-day moving average of $144.07. The company has a market cap of $28.51 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 11.55,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.86 and a beta of 0.77. The company has a quick ratio of 1.00, a current ratio of 0.94 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.44. M&T Bank has a 52 week low of $108.53 and a 52 week high of $175.00.

M&T Bank (NYSE:MTBG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 18th. The financial services provider reported $3.73 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$3.50 by $0.23. The business had revenue of $3.37 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.27 billion. M&T Bank had a return on equity of 9.62% and a net margin of 17.84%.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$5.12 earnings per share. On average, equities analysts forecast that M&T Bank will post 13.95 earnings per share for the current year.

M&T Bank Increases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, June 28th. Stockholders of record on Monday, June 3rd were paid a $1.35 dividend. This is an increase from M&T Bank’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.30. This represents a $5.40 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.16%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, June 3rd. M&T Bank’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 36.51%.

M&T Bank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

M&T Bank Corporation operates as a bank holding company for Manufacturers and Traders Trust Company and Wilmington Trust, National Association that engages in the provision of retail and commercial banking products and services in the United States. The company operates through three segments: Commercial Bank, Retail Bank, and Institutional Services and Wealth Management.
